20140008109METHOD FOR PRODUCING CONDUCTIVE ZINC OXIDE FILM - An objective is to provide a novel preparation method for a conductive ZnO film which realizes large area and mass productions with low costs and low environment loads. The crystal of zinc oxide (ZnO) is deposited on a substrate by a precipitation method using liquidous solution method under the presence of citric acid. The citric acid adsorbs on the surface of (0001) face of ZnO to suppress anisotropic growth to a c axis direction of the crystal in the precipitation reaction and to form dense crystal film on the surface of the substrate. Then, the organic acid incorporated in the film is photo-decomposed by irradiating UV light to the prepared ZnO crystalline film. As the result, carriers trapped by the organic acid is released to the crystalline film so as to provide an adequate conductivity.01-09-2014

20090073608Perpendicular magnetic recording head - Embodiments of the present invention provide a perpendicular magnetic recording head suitable for high density recording that suppresses erasure after recording by reducing the remanent magnetization Mr of the main magnetic pole and thereby decreasing the squareness S. Accordingly to one embodiment, a main magnetic pole piece of a perpendicular magnetic recording head includes a FeCo ferromagnetic layer, into which a NiFe soft magnetic layer is inserted. Inserting the NiFe soft magnetic layer in a position in the FeCo ferromagnetic layer 1 to 7 mm away from a nonmagnetic layer allows a remanent magnetization Mr to be decreased without changing the number of layers of the nonmagnetic layer or a film thickness of the FeCo ferromagnetic layer. This helps suppress erasure after recording.03-19-2009
